Factors Affecting the Range of Geely Plug-in Vehicles

Battery Capacity

The battery capacity is one of the most significant factors influencing the range of a plug-in vehicle. A larger battery can store more energy, allowing the vehicle to travel a longer distance on a single charge. Geely has been investing heavily in battery technology to improve the energy density and capacity of its batteries. For example, the latest models are equipped with high-capacity lithium-ion batteries that offer enhanced performance and range.

Driving Conditions

Driving conditions play a vital role in determining the actual range of a plug-in vehicle. Factors such as speed, traffic, road terrain, and weather can all have an impact. High-speed driving, frequent acceleration and deceleration, and driving on hilly terrain can increase energy consumption and reduce the range. In contrast, driving at a steady speed on flat roads and in moderate weather conditions can help maximize the range.

Vehicle Weight and Aerodynamics

The weight of the vehicle and its aerodynamic design also affect the range. Heavier vehicles require more energy to move, which can reduce the range. Geely has been working on optimizing the vehicle's weight through the use of lightweight materials such as aluminum and high-strength steel. Additionally, the aerodynamic design of the vehicle can reduce drag, which in turn improves energy efficiency and increases the range.

Energy Management System

Geely's plug-in vehicles are equipped with advanced energy management systems that help optimize the use of energy. These systems can monitor and control the battery's charging and discharging processes, as well as adjust the power output of the electric motor based on driving conditions. By efficiently managing the energy, the range of the vehicle can be extended.

Tips to Maximize the Range of Geely Plug-in Vehicles

Efficient Driving Habits

Adopting efficient driving habits can significantly improve the range of a plug-in vehicle. This includes driving at a steady speed, avoiding sudden acceleration and braking, and using regenerative braking whenever possible. Regenerative braking converts the kinetic energy generated during braking into electrical energy, which can be stored in the battery and used later.

Proper Battery Maintenance

Proper battery maintenance is essential for ensuring the longevity and performance of the battery. This includes keeping the battery charged between 20% and 80% of its capacity, avoiding extreme temperatures, and following the manufacturer's recommended charging procedures. By taking good care of the battery, the range of the vehicle can be maintained over time.

Use of Eco Mode

Most Geely plug-in vehicles are equipped with an eco mode, which adjusts the vehicle's performance to maximize energy efficiency. When eco mode is activated, the vehicle may reduce the power output of the electric motor, adjust the climate control settings, and optimize other systems to conserve energy. Using eco mode can help extend the range of the vehicle, especially during long trips.
